【笔记】Swift的数组

前言

Swift的数组

定义数组字面量

1
[值, 值]

定义数组变量

1
var arr = [值, 值]

定义二维数组

1
var arr = [[值, 值], [值, 值]]

获取指定下标的元素

  • 既可以通过字面量直接获取,也可以通过变量获取
1
[值, 值][下标]
1
arr[下标]

随机获取数组中的元素

  • 随机获取数组中的随机一个元素
1
arr.randomElement()

随机打乱数组中元素的位置

1
arr.shuffle()

获取数组长度

1
arr.count

遍历数组并修改数据

1
arr = arr.map{$0 + 1}

完成

参考文献

哔哩哔哩——疯狂滴小黑